The Mechanics of Mild Steel Scrap Pricing
The pricing of scrap steel is rarely static. It is governed by the ‘ferrous cycle,’ which links the price of virgin iron ore to the demand for recycled content in new steel production. When global infrastructure projects increase, the demand for steel spikes, pushing up the price per tonne. Conversely, when manufacturing slows, the surplus of scrap steel drives prices down. In Australia, local scrap metal prices today are heavily influenced by our export relationships with Asian steel mills. These mills require consistent, high-quality feedstock, and your scrap must meet specific cleanliness standards to command the top market rate. Beyond global trends, local logistics play a massive role. The cost of transporting heavy metal often exceeds the value of the material itself if the volume is too low. This is why commercial sellers often receive better rates than residential sellers; the economy of scale allows recyclers to absorb the logistics costs. Categorizing Your Scrap: Grades and Quality
Not all steel is created equal. To get the best mild steel scrap price, you must understand how recyclers grade your material. Ferrous metal is generally sorted into categories like ‘Heavy Melting Steel’ (HMS) 1 and 2, ‘Plate and Structural’ (P&S), and ‘Light Gauge’ or ‘Sheet’ steel. HMS 1 consists of thicker, cleaner sections of steel, which are highly prized because they have a lower surface-area-to-mass ratio, meaning they oxidize less and melt more efficiently in an electric arc furnace. If your scrap contains contaminants like plastic, rubber, or non-ferrous metals, it will be downgraded, significantly reducing your price per kg.
It is also important to distinguish your mild steel from other alloys. The Environmental and Economic Impact of Recycling
Recycling steel is one of the most energy-efficient industrial processes in existence. By using scrap steel instead of virgin iron ore, manufacturers can reduce energy consumption by up to 75% and carbon emissions by 80%. This is because the energy required to melt down existing steel is significantly lower than the energy required to mine, crush, transport, and refine raw iron ore. Best Practices for Maximizing Your Returns
To consistently secure the best mild steel scrap price, preparation is key. First, ensure your scrap is free of ‘attachments.’ This includes removing hydraulic cylinders, heavy bolts, or concrete chunks from steel beams. Recyclers charge a ‘deduction’ for contaminants, which is often calculated as a percentage of the total weight. If your load is 10% concrete by weight, you are losing 10% of your potential revenue immediately. Second, sort your scrap by size. If you have large, oversized pieces, consider cutting them down to standard furnace sizes (typically under 1.5 meters). This makes the material easier for the recycler to process and often qualifies you for a premium ‘prepared’ price.
Third, keep an eye on market cycles. While you cannot control the global steel price per tonne, you can control when you sell. If you have the storage space, it is often wise to accumulate scrap during periods of low market activity and sell when demand peaks. Finally, build a relationship with a local yard. A yard that knows you provide clean, well-sorted material will prioritize your loads and offer better service. Always ask for a printed weighbridge ticket and ensure the scale is certified, as transparency is the cornerstone of a fair trade in the scrap metal industry. Frequently Asked Questions
Why does the mild steel scrap price fluctuate so much?
Prices fluctuate based on global demand for steel, the cost of iron ore, and energy prices. Because steel is a global commodity, international supply chain disruptions or shifts in manufacturing output in major economies directly impact the local price per kg.
How can I get a better price for my scrap steel?
The best way to increase your return is to ensure your scrap is clean and sorted. Removing non-metallic contaminants like wood, concrete, and plastic, and separating different grades of metal, will prevent the recycler from applying deductions to your final payment.
Is there a minimum amount of scrap I need to sell?
Most commercial scrap yards accept small loads, but you will get the best value and potentially free collection services if you have larger volumes. It is always recommended to call your local yard ahead of time to discuss your specific load size and current pricing.
Does the size of the steel pieces affect the price?
Yes, ‘prepared’ steel—which is cut into manageable, furnace-ready sizes—often fetches a higher price than ‘unprepared’ or oversized scrap. Recyclers pay more for material that requires less processing time and equipment to prepare for the smelter.
